25-28 September in the heart of Orlando. Terrific gaming facility, nice rooms, plenty of choices for dining and "after battle" drink or two to discuss the games. Park your car when you arrive and no need to use it again until you pack up with all the items you picked up at the show.

Bob Moon's award winning Gettysburg game, a weekend of The Sword and the Flame, Stan Kubiak's Aerodrome games, a weekend full of Seekrieg games with the author's, just a few of the events awaiting that perfect wargame weekend.
